How Hysterectomies Affect Women’s Health

March 19th, 2007

A radical surgery that is sometimes performed on women who have uterine fibroids, endometriosis, cancer of the reproductive organs, pelvic adhesions, or heavy bleeding is a hysterectomy. Hyster is the Greek word for womb and ectomy means removal, therefore a hysterectomy is the removal of the womb.
